无论是云计算平台、电子商务平台、金融交易系统,还是内部管理系统,服务器服务的稳定性和连续性直接关系到企业的业务效率、客户满意度乃至市场竞争力
因此,服务器服务保活(Service Keep-Alive)成为了一项至关重要的任务,它旨在通过一系列技术手段和管理策略,确保服务器及其服务在面临各种挑战时仍能持续稳定运行,从而保障企业的业务连续性
一、服务器服务保活的重要性 1.业务连续性保障:服务器作为数据存储、处理与传输的核心,其服务的连续性直接关系到企业能否正常运营
一旦服务器服务中断,可能导致数据丢失、交易失败、客户体验下降等一系列严重后果,进而影响企业的声誉和经济效益
2.数据安全性提升:保活机制不仅关注服务的连续性,还涉及数据的备份、恢复与加密,有效防止因单点故障导致的数据丢失或被篡改,增强企业的数据安全防护能力
3.用户体验优化:对于面向消费者的服务而言,高可用性意味着更少的停机时间和更快的响应时间,从而提升用户体验,增强用户粘性
4.成本效益最大化:通过有效的保活策略,可以减少因服务中断导致的经济损失,同时优化资源分配,提高服务器的使用效率和成本效益
二、服务器服务保活的主要策略 1.负载均衡与故障转移 负载均衡技术通过将请求分散到多台服务器上,避免单一服务器过载,提高系统的整体处理能力和稳定性
而故障转移机制则能在检测到某台服务器故障时,迅速将业务切换到其他健康的服务器上,确保服务不中断
这要求企业构建冗余的服务器架构,如主备模式、集群模式等,以实现无缝切换
2.健康监测与自动重启 实施定期的健康检查,包括CPU使用率、内存占用、磁盘空间、网络连接状态等关键指标的监控,能够及时发现潜在问题
一旦检测到异常,系统应能自动触发预警,并在必要时自动重启服务或服务器,以恢复服务状态
这种自动化响应机制大大缩短了故障恢复时间,减少了人工干预的需要
3.数据备份与恢复 数据是企业最宝贵的资产之一
建立定期的数据备份策略,包括全量备份和增量备份,以及异地备份,可以有效防止数据丢失
同时,开发高效的数据恢复流程,确保在数据损坏或丢失时能够迅速恢复,是保障业务连续性的重要一环
4.软件更新与补丁管理 及时应用操作系统、数据库、应用程序的安全补丁和更新,是防范已知漏洞和攻击的重要手段
企业应建立自动化的补丁管理系统,确保所有服务器都能及时获得最新的安全更新,同时测试补丁的兼容性,避免更新引入新的问题
5.容灾演练与应急响应计划 制定详细的容灾恢复计划和应急响应流程,并定期进行模拟演练,是检验和提升系统恢复能力的关键
通过演练,可以发现并修正计划中的不足,提高团队在真实灾难发生时的应对效率和协同能力
6.智能监控与分析 利用AI和大数据分析技术,对服务器运行数据进行深度挖掘,可以预测潜在故障,提前采取措施
智能监控系统能够自动识别异常模式,发出预警,甚至自动执行预设的故障处理脚本,极大地提高了运维的效率和准确性
三、实施服务器服务保活的挑战与对策 1.技术复杂度:随着技术的不断进步,服务器环境日益复杂,保活策略的实施需要跨越多平台、多架构,技术门槛较高
对策是加强技术培训,引入专业的运维团队或第三方服务提供商,利用他们的专业知识和经验来优化保活策略
2.成本投入:构建冗余架构、采用高级监控工具和技术,都会增加企业的运营成本
对此,企业应合理规划预算,权衡成本与收益,选择性价比高的解决方案
3.合规性与隐私保护:在数据备份、传输和处理过程中,必须严格遵守相关法律法规,保护用户隐私
企业应建立完善的合规体系,定期进行合规审计,确保所有操作合法合规
4.人员意识与培训:运维人员的专业技能和应急处理能力直接影响保活策略的有效性
企业应定期组织培训,提升团队的专业素养,同时建立激励机制,鼓励员工主动学习新知识、新技术
四、结语 服务器服务保活是确保企业业务连续性的基石,它要求企业在技术、管理、人员等多个层面进行全面布局和优化
通过实施负载均衡、健康监测、数据备份、软件更新、容灾演练以及智能监控等策略,企业可以显著提升服务器的稳定性和安全性,为业务的持续健康发展提供坚实保障
面对不断变化的技术环境和业务需求,企业应保持敏锐的洞察力,持续优化保活策略,以适应未来的挑战
在这个过程中,既要注重技术创新,也要强化人员管理,构建一套既高效又灵活的服务器服务保活体系,让企业在激烈的市场竞争中立于不败之地